Conditions at Playa Cocles in September

September: The Seasonal Floor

September is one of the weakest months of the year at Playa Cocles. The average swell height limps in at 0.6m (2ft), the period is a short 7.0s, and ideal wind falls to 23%. NE swell still represents 82.2% of the spectrum, and ENE adds another 16.5%, but the height distribution is heavily skewed toward small surf: 23.3% of NE swells are under 0.5m and 52.9% are in the 0.5-1m (2-3ft) range. Only 6% of NE swells reach 1-1.5m (3-5ft). The wind is dominated by NNW (21.5%) and NW (20.6%), with the offshore southerly quadrant rarely firing. This is the heart of the wet season, with 8.33mm/day of rain and water temperatures peaking at 29.2°C. It can still be worthwhile if a tropical wave brings extra energy, but the default setting is small and lumpy.
